package com.ynxbd.common.helper.common;
|
|
|
|
/**
|
|
* @author wsq
|
|
* @description 雪花算法
|
|
* @date 2019/8/14 下午8:22
|
|
*/
|
|
public class SnowHelper {
|
|
/**
|
|
* 起始的时间戳
|
|
*/
|
|
private final static long START_STAMP = 3500522218L;
|
|
|
|
/**
|
|
* 每一部分占用的位数
|
|
*/
|
|
private final static long SEQUENCE_BIT = 12; // 序列号占用的位数
|
|
private final static long MACHINE_BIT = 5; // 机器标识占用的位数
|
|
private final static long DATACENTER_BIT = 5; // 数据中心占用的位数
|
|
|
|
/**
|
|
* 每一部分的最大值
|
|
*/
|
|
private final static long MAX_DATACENTER_NUM = ~(-1L << DATACENTER_BIT);
|
|
private final static long MAX_MACHINE_NUM = ~(-1L << MACHINE_BIT);
|
|
private final static long MAX_SEQUENCE = ~(-1L << SEQUENCE_BIT);
|
|
|
|
/**
|
|
* 每一部分向左的位移
|
|
*/
|
|
private final static long MACHINE_LEFT = SEQUENCE_BIT;
|
|
private final static long DATACENTER_LEFT = SEQUENCE_BIT + MACHINE_BIT;
|
|
private final static long TIME_STAMP_LEFT = DATACENTER_LEFT + DATACENTER_BIT;
|
|
|
|
private long datacenterId; // 数据中心
|
|
private long machineId; // 机器标识
|
|
private long sequence = 0L; // 序列号
|
|
private long lastStamp = -1L; // 上一次时间戳
|
|
|
|
public SnowHelper(long datacenterId, long machineId) {
|
|
if (datacenterId > MAX_DATACENTER_NUM || datacenterId < 0) {
|
|
throw new IllegalArgumentException("datacenterId can't be greater than MAX_DATACENTER_NUM or less than 0");
|
|
}
|
|
if (machineId > MAX_MACHINE_NUM || machineId < 0) {
|
|
throw new IllegalArgumentException("machineId can't be greater than MAX_MACHINE_NUM or less than 0");
|
|
}
|
|
this.datacenterId = datacenterId;
|
|
this.machineId = machineId;
|
|
}
|
|
|
|
/**
|
|
* 产生下一个ID
|
|
*
|
|
*/
|
|
public synchronized long nextId() {
|
|
long curTimeStamp = getCurTime();
|
|
if (curTimeStamp < lastStamp) {
|
|
throw new RuntimeException("Clock moved backwards. Refusing to generate id");
|
|
}
|
|
|
|
if (curTimeStamp == lastStamp) {
|
|
//相同毫秒内,序列号自增
|
|
sequence = (sequence + 1) & MAX_SEQUENCE;
|
|
//同一毫秒的序列数已经达到最大
|
|
if (sequence == 0L) {
|
|
curTimeStamp = getNextMill();
|
|
}
|
|
} else {
|
|
//不同毫秒内,序列号置为0
|
|
sequence = 0L;
|
|
}
|
|
|
|
lastStamp = curTimeStamp;
|
|
|
|
return (curTimeStamp - START_STAMP) << TIME_STAMP_LEFT //时间戳部分
|
|
| datacenterId << DATACENTER_LEFT //数据中心部分
|
|
| machineId << MACHINE_LEFT //机器标识部分
|
|
| sequence; //序列号部分
|
|
}
|
|
|
|
private long getNextMill() {
|
|
long mill = getCurTime();
|
|
while (mill <= lastStamp) {
|
|
mill = getCurTime();
|
|
}
|
|
return mill;
|
|
}
|
|
|
|
private long getCurTime() {
|
|
return System.currentTimeMillis();
|
|
}
|
|
|
|
public static void main(String[] args) {
|
|
SnowHelper snowFlake = new SnowHelper(2, 3);
|
|
for (int i = 0; i < (1 << 12); i++) {
|
|
System.out.println(snowFlake.nextId());
|
|
}
|
|
}
|
|
|
|
|
|
} |
